The Hurley school district is closing for several weeks because of the coronavirus.
Superintendent Kevin Genisot announced the schools will be closed from Monday, March 16 through Monday, April 13.
Genisot said all activities will be canceled. He says there will be no practices or general school use of the facility in any capacity.
Genisot says the final decision on school board meetings has not been decided.
Genisot says more updates on the status of the closing of the Hurley schools until April 13 will be coming.
